About

nearly 2200 gross square feet, with 843 sf of outdoor roof garden + 1359 interior sf of sumptuous interior stylish loft with 10'6" ceiling and light on 3 sides, make this a fantastic chelsea value. it is the largest penthouse unit at this premier sold out loft conversion of an 1888 former brick walled livery and warehouse. the interior features three exposures n, e, and s, with a gigantic br with s and e exposures. a chef's kitchen with a miele gas range and electric broiler, en place custom white lacquer cabinets, bosch dw and gray french limestone counters make entertaining effortless and stylish. custom tilt & turn oak windows, cac + radiant perimeter heat and a working gas fireplace make this a comfortable loft year long. water, gas, and electric connections already in place and awaiting your designer on the open sky roof garden that is private to your loft alone. half a block to the whole foods market. 1, 9, e, c, d, path, n&r with madison pk too, who could ask for more?
